Output 23b3083f56c07324cd2d61e133358816648402cc2d975e84ab99412fbd24f353:0

value
1086684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3108381ef91752443d7c47e5fe179760d1d0e60e OP_EQUAL
address
36AGt2QVsA1AtH96DbiakvZxyuiij2u4HU
transaction
23b3083f56c07324cd2d61e133358816648402cc2d975e84ab99412fbd24f353
spent
true